build(deps): bump cryptography from 44.0.2 to 45.0.3 in /docker/google-api-py3
Bumps cryptography from 44.0.2 to 45.0.3.
Changelog
Sourced from cryptography's changelog.
45.0.3 - 2025-05-25
* Fixed decrypting PKCS#8 files encrypted with long salts (this impacts keys encrypted by Bouncy Castle). * Fixed decrypting PKCS#8 files encrypted with DES-CBC-MD5. While wildly insecure, this remains prevalent... _v45-0-2:
45.0.2 - 2025-05-17
- Fixed using
mypywithcryptographyon older versions of Python... _v45-0-1:
45.0.1 - 2025-05-17
* Updated Windows, macOS, and Linux wheels to be compiled with OpenSSL 3.5.0... _v45-0-0:
45.0.0 - 2025-05-17 (YANKED)
- Support for Python 3.7 is deprecated and will be removed in the next
cryptographyrelease.- Updated the minimum supported Rust version (MSRV) to 1.74.0, from 1.65.0.
- Added support for serialization of PKCS#12 Java truststores in :func:
~cryptography.hazmat.primitives.serialization.pkcs12.serialize_java_truststore- Added :meth:
~cryptography.hazmat.primitives.kdf.argon2.Argon2id.derive_phc_encodedand :meth:~cryptography.hazmat.primitives.kdf.argon2.Argon2id.verify_phc_encodedmethods to support password hashing in the PHC string format- Added support for PKCS7 decryption and encryption using AES-256 as the content algorithm, in addition to AES-128.
- BACKWARDS INCOMPATIBLE: Made SSH private key loading more consistent with other private key loading: :func:
~cryptography.hazmat.primitives.serialization.load_ssh_private_keynow raises aTypeErrorif the key is unencrypted but a password is provided (previously no exception was raised), and raises aTypeErrorif the key is encrypted but no password is provided (previously aValueErrorwas raised).- Added
__copy__to the :class:~cryptography.hazmat.primitives.asymmetric.ec.EllipticCurvePrivateKey, :class:~cryptography.hazmat.primitives.asymmetric.ec.EllipticCurvePublicKey, :class:~cryptography.hazmat.primitives.asymmetric.ed25519.Ed25519PublicKey, :class:~cryptography.hazmat.primitives.asymmetric.ed25519.Ed25519PrivateKey, :class:~cryptography.hazmat.primitives.asymmetric.ed448.Ed448PublicKey,
... (truncated)
Commits
5038495backports for 45.0.3 release (#12979)f81c075Backport mypy fixes for release (#12930)8ea28e0bump for 45.0.1 (#12922)6784097bump for 45 release (#12886)2d9c1c9bump MSRV to 1.74 (#12919)6c18874Bump BoringSSL, OpenSSL, AWS-LC in CI (#12918)43fd312add test vectors for upcoming explicit curve loading (#12913)6bfa0a3chore(deps): bump asn1 from 0.21.2 to 0.21.3 (#12914)a88dd66chore(deps): bump cc from 1.2.22 to 1.2.23 (#12912)e4e9840chore(deps): bump uv from 0.7.3 to 0.7.4 in /.github/requirements (#12911)- Additional commits viewable in compare view
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.
Dependabot commands and options
You can trigger Dependabot actions by commenting on this PR:
-
@dependabot rebasewill rebase this PR -
@dependabot recreatewill recreate this PR, overwriting any edits that have been made to it -
@dependabot mergewill merge this PR after your CI passes on it -
@dependabot squash and mergewill squash and merge this PR after your CI passes on it -
@dependabot cancel mergewill cancel a previously requested merge and block automerging -
@dependabot reopenwill reopen this PR if it is closed -
@dependabot closewill close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ually -
@dependabot show <dependency name> ignore conditionswill show all of the ignore conditions of the specified dependency -
@dependabot ignore this major versionwill close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self) -
@dependabot ignore this minor versionwill close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self) -
@dependabot ignore this dependencywill close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)
Docker Image Ready - Dev
Docker automatic build has deployed your docker image: devdemisto/google-api-py3:1.0.0.3546300 It is available now on docker hub at: https://hub.docker.com/r/devdemisto/google-api-py3/tags Get started by pulling the image:
docker pull devdemisto/google-api-py3:1.0.0.3546300
Docker Metadata
- Image Size:
82.56 MB - Image ID:
sha256:95d5d5c15e89ad78da21e4b15c629ba6534db83b382579052658a68074a2adfd - Created:
2025-05-26T14:49:48.360206039Z - Arch:
linux/amd64 - Command:
["python3"] - Environment:
-
PATH=/usr/local/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in -
LANG=C.UTF-8 -
GPG_KEY=7169605F62C751356D054A26A821E680E5FA6305 -
PYTHON_VERSION=3.12.10 -
PYTHON_SHA256=07ab697474595e06f06647417d3c7fa97ded07afc1a7e4454c5639919b46eaea -
DOCKER_IMAGE=devdemisto/google-api-py3:1.0.0.3546300
-
- Labels:
-
org.opencontainers.image.authors:Demisto <[email protected]> -
org.opencontainers.image.revision:8213b62d06396822f4ddc150403fa1643336d832 -
org.opencontainers.image.version:1.0.0.3546300
-
Docker Image Ready - Dev
Docker automatic build has deployed your docker image: devdemisto/google-api-py3:1.0.0.3639919 It is available now on docker hub at: https://hub.docker.com/r/devdemisto/google-api-py3/tags Get started by pulling the image:
docker pull devdemisto/google-api-py3:1.0.0.3639919
Docker Metadata
- Image Size:
85.86 MB - Image ID:
sha256:1d50c57d66ef0e6e0e0570b45e0c03a5a552c3a1568660499b48be9c9a775f0b - Created:
2025-06-04T15:43:57.94813314Z - Arch:
linux/amd64 - Command:
["python3"] - Environment:
-
PATH=/usr/local/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in -
LANG=C.UTF-8 -
GPG_KEY=7169605F62C751356D054A26A821E680E5FA6305 -
PYTHON_VERSION=3.12.10 -
PYTHON_SHA256=07ab697474595e06f06647417d3c7fa97ded07afc1a7e4454c5639919b46eaea -
DOCKER_IMAGE=devdemisto/google-api-py3:1.0.0.3639919
-
- Labels:
-
org.opencontainers.image.authors:Demisto <[email protected]> -
org.opencontainers.image.revision:341260913a0ef609aee022b39b5a5e318dee9658 -
org.opencontainers.image.version:1.0.0.3639919
-
Docker Image Ready - Dev
Docker automatic build has deployed your docker image: devdemisto/google-api-py3:1.0.0.3639984 It is available now on docker hub at: https://hub.docker.com/r/devdemisto/google-api-py3/tags Get started by pulling the image:
docker pull devdemisto/google-api-py3:1.0.0.3639984
Docker Metadata
- Image Size:
85.86 MB - Image ID:
sha256:e9419a9d8f30532fc5e541d7645f833b3aae78aee2c075f94bf80fb389e0b548 - Created:
2025-06-04T15:49:20.393573259Z - Arch:
linux/amd64 - Command:
["python3"] - Environment:
-
PATH=/usr/local/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in -
LANG=C.UTF-8 -
GPG_KEY=7169605F62C751356D054A26A821E680E5FA6305 -
PYTHON_VERSION=3.12.10 -
PYTHON_SHA256=07ab697474595e06f06647417d3c7fa97ded07afc1a7e4454c5639919b46eaea -
DOCKER_IMAGE=devdemisto/google-api-py3:1.0.0.3639984
-
- Labels:
-
org.opencontainers.image.authors:Demisto <[email protected]> -
org.opencontainers.image.revision:3d1a0c1d190ed4d31efda7800c8713a137c2427f -
org.opencontainers.image.version:1.0.0.3639984
-
Superseded by #37924.